What Is A Biodigester? (And Why Is Everyone Talking About It?)

A biodigester is an enclosed system that breaks down human waste using naturally occurring microorganisms. Instead of storing waste and waiting for an exhaustion truck to clear it out every few months, a biodigester digests the waste biologically. It does so continuously, quietly, and without any foul smell.

Think of a biodigester as a self-cleaning sewage system. Once installed and activated with bioenzymes, it handles your household waste on its own, day after day, with very little input from you.

In Kenya, two main types of biodigesters exist:

  1. The traditional concrete biodigester (built on-site by masons)
  2. The modern plastic biodigester (factory-made, ready to install).

The Difference Between A Biodigester And A Septic Tank

Before we go further, let’s first clear up a common confusion… Many people use the terms biodigester and septic tank interchangeably, but they are not the same thing.

Here’s what each term means:

  • A septic tank collects and partially separates waste. Solids sink to the bottom, liquids flow out. But the solids accumulate. And every few months, you pay a tanker to come and pump out the sludge. That cost adds up fast, and if you’ve ever been around when the exhaustion truck arrives, you know the smell is something you don’t forget.
  • A biodigester, on the other hand, doesn’t just store waste; it digests it. Bacteria and enzymes break the waste down into water and gas. Unlike a septic tank, there’s little to no sludge accumulation, so no exhaustion truck is needed (you end up saving more money here). And the best part? No foul smell! Simply put, a biodigester is just a system doing its job quietly underground.

How Does A Biodigester Work?

As a Kenyan homeowner, understanding how a biodigester works helps you appreciate why it needs so little maintenance. Modern plastic biodigesters like those made by Bio Tank Africa are now available in Kenya and use a three-chamber system.

Here’s what happens inside:

Chamber 1: Primary Digestion

Waste from your toilets enters the first chamber. Here, anaerobic bacteria (bacteria that thrive without oxygen) begin breaking down the solid organic matter. (Source).

While these bacteria are naturally present in human waste, adding bioenzymes during installation and as regular maintenance helps accelerate the process significantly.

The heavy solids begin to liquefy and settle. Gases produced during this process (mostly methane and carbon dioxide) are vented safely through a pipe above the ground.

Chamber 2: Secondary Treatment

The partially treated effluent flows from the first chamber into the second, where further bacterial digestion takes place. By this stage, most of the solid organic matter has been broken down. What remains is a liquid that is much cleaner and safer than raw sewage.

Chamber 3: Final Polishing

The third chamber receives the clarified liquid from chamber two. Here, any remaining solids settle, and the liquid undergoes final treatment. What eventually exits the system is a relatively clean, odorless effluent that can safely drain into a soak pit.

The Role of Bioenzymes In Biodigester Systems

Bioenzymes—like BioClean, which Bio Tank Africa supplies—are concentrated cultures of beneficial bacteria. Adding them to your biodigester when you first install it seeds the system with the right microorganisms to get the digestion process going quickly.

A small maintenance dose every few months keeps the bacterial colony healthy and active.

No bioenzymes means the system still works, but slower and less efficiently. With them, you get faster breakdown, zero odour, and a longer system lifespan.

Installation Costs of Biodigesters in Kenya

One of the things that makes plastic biodigesters genuinely affordable is that you DON’T need to hire a specialist for installation.

Any qualified plumber can do the job. This is a significant saving compared to a concrete biodigester, which requires a skilled mason and several days of construction work.

Installation costs in Nairobi typically depend on:

  • Depth of excavation: Rocky terrain (common in parts of Nairobi like Karen, Ngong, and Ruaka) requires more labour
  • Distance from the house: Longer pipe runs cost more
  • Labour rates in your area: Nairobi rates differ from peri-urban areas like Thika or Kitengela

A good plumber should be able to complete a standard residential installation in one day.

Ongoing Costs: The Real Long-Term Savings

Here’s where the biodigester truly shines over the septic tank:

A conventional septic tank in a busy household may need exhaustion every 1–3 months. At current Nairobi rates, a single exhaustion can cost you anywhere from KSh 5,000 to KSh 15,000, depending on tank size and your location.

Over five years, this cost adds up to a substantial amount of money: money a biodigester owner simply never spends.

The ONLY ongoing cost for a biodigester is bioenzyme top-ups, which are inexpensive and infrequent. That’s a dramatically different maintenance bill over the lifetime of the system.

Is A Biodigester Right for Your Property?

Before purchasing a biodigester, here are a few questions worth thinking through to help you make a wiser decision:

How many people use the property daily? This determines the size you need. Don’t undersize a unit for a busy rental or commercial property.

What is the soil type on your plot? Sandy or loam soils drain efficiently. If your land has heavy clay soil, you may need a slightly larger soakpit to handle the effluent output.

Is your plot on rocky terrain? This affects excavation depth and labour cost, but doesn’t prevent installation. Plastic biodigesters are compact enough to work even on shallow rocky plots.

Are you on a tight urban plot? The beauty of a 3-chamber plastic biodigester is its small footprint. You don’t need a large plot for it to work.

Do you have existing sewage infrastructure? If you’re renovating a property that already has a septic tank, you can often connect to or replace it with a biodigester. A qualified plumber can assess what’s needed.

How To Install A Biodigester In Kenya: Step by Step Guide

Knowing how to install a biodigester is important as it helps you plan your timeline and brief your contractor properly.

Step 1: Site Assessment

Before anything is purchased, you’ll need to first assess where the tank will be placed. It should be accessible (not directly under a building), have a clear pipe route from your toilets, and be positioned where effluent can drain safely into a soak pit.

Step 2: Excavation

Your plumber or casual labourer excavates a hole to the required depth and dimensions for your chosen tank size. For a standard 1.4m³ unit, this is a relatively small excavation that most teams complete in a few hours on normal soil.

Step 3: Tank Placement

The plastic biodigester unit is lowered into the excavation. Because it’s a factory-made unit, there’s no on-site construction involved. You’re essentially placing a ready-made system into the ground.

Step 4: Pipe Connection

Your plumber connects the inlet pipe (from your toilets/bathrooms) to the tank’s entry point, and the outlet pipe from the tank to your soak pit. A proper gradient on the inlet pipe is important to ensure waste flows smoothly by gravity.

Step 5: Backfilling

Once connections are confirmed and tested, the hole is carefully backfilled around the tank. The plastic unit is designed to withstand the pressure of the surrounding soil.

Step 6: Bioenzyme Seeding

This is a step many installers skip, but shouldn’t. Adding bioenzymes at commissioning seeds the tank with the bacteria it needs to start digesting waste efficiently from day one. Bio Tank Africa supplies BioClean specifically for this purpose.

Step 7: Testing

Run water through the system and confirm flow from the inlet to the outlet is smooth. Check all connections for leaks. Your plumber should confirm the system is functioning before leaving the site.

From excavation to testing, a standard residential installation typically takes one full day.

Maintaining Your Biodigester: What You Actually Need to Do

One of the most appealing things about a plastic biodigester is what you don’t have to do: No monthly exhaustion costs. No professional cleaning. No electricity to manage.

Here’s what you need to do, and how often:

Monthly:

  • Check that your soak pit is draining properly. If you notice pooling water near the soak pit area, it may need expanding or clearing.

Every 3–6 Months:

  • Add a maintenance dose of bioenzymes (Bioclean) through your toilet. This tops up the bacterial colony and keeps digestion running at full efficiency.

What to Avoid:

A biodigester is a living system, which means that anything that kills the bacteria inside will damage its performance. Avoid flushing:

  • Bleach and strong chemical cleaners in large quantities. Just small amounts from normal toilet cleaning are fine, but pouring undiluted bleach directly into the toilet regularly will harm the bacterial colony
  • Antibiotics in large quantities (this is rarely a practical issue for most households)
  • Non-biodegradable materials such as wipes, sanitary pads, nappies, and plastic should never go into any sewage system
  • Cooking oils and grease in large amounts; these should go into a grease trap before reaching the biodigester

Follow these simple guidelines and your biodigester will serve your household efficiently for decades.

Frequently Asked Questions About Biodigesters in Kenya

Here are quick answers to some of the most common questions about biodigesters in Kenya:

1. How long does a plastic biodigester last?

A good-quality plastic biodigester, properly installed and maintained, should last 30 to 50 years or more. The high-density polyethylene (HDPE) plastic used in modern units is resistant to soil pressure, moisture, and the chemical environment inside the tank, enhancing the unit’s longevity.

2. Does a biodigester smell?

No. And this is one of the biggest reasons homeowners prefer it over a conventional septic tank. As long as the system is correctly installed (with a proper vent pipe) and bioenzymes are maintained, there should be no odour at all. Smell is usually a sign of an installation error or a depleted bacterial colony that needs a bioenzyme top-up.

3. Can I install a biodigester if my plot is on rocky ground?

Yes. This is one of the advantages of a compact plastic biodigester over a concrete option. Plastic units require less excavation depth and can be accommodated even on rocky plots in areas like Karen, Ngong, Lavington, and parts of Kiambu. Your plumber will assess the best positioning.

4. Do I still need a soakpit with a biodigester?

Yes. The biodigester treats the waste, but the final clarified effluent still needs somewhere to drain. A soakpit (also called a drain field or leach pit) is a simple underground pit filled with gravel that allows the treated water to slowly percolate into the surrounding soil. Your plumber will size and position this alongside the tank.

5. Is a biodigester approved by county authorities in Kenya?

Generally, yes. Most county governments and the National Construction Authority (NCA) recognize biodigesters as a compliant sewage treatment solution. In fact, in many planned estates and new developments, a biodigester is the preferred or mandated option. Always check with your specific county’s environmental and building department for confirmation, especially for commercial developments.

6. Can a biodigester handle waste from a rental property?

Absolutely. In fact, rental properties—bedsitters, one-bedroom units, studio apartments—are one of the most common use cases for biodigesters in Kenya. The key is sizing the unit correctly. A property with 10 rental units housing 2–3 people each needs a much larger system than a single-family home. Bio Tank Africa can advise on commercial sizing.

7. What happens if the biodigester gets full?

A properly functioning biodigester rarely “gets full” in the way a septic tank does, because the waste is continuously broken down. If you notice the system backing up, it’s usually a sign that the bacterial colony needs attention (a bioenzyme dose usually solves this), there’s a blockage in the inlet or outlet pipe, or the unit was undersized for the number of users.
